WebFeb 3, 2024 · In 2024, the federal base payment is $914 (up from $841 in 2024). For a couple where both spouses receive SSI, the monthly payment is $1,371 in 2024 (up from $1,261 in 2024). WebWhen you've earned $6,560 you've earned your 4 credits for the year. The number of work credits you need to qualify for disability benefits depends on your age when your disability begins. If you had difficulty receiving … If you remarry after you reach age 60 (age 50 if you have a disability), the … WebFeb 25, 2024 · As noted before, Federal Disability Retirement is a medical-based retirement available for FERS and CSRS employees. However, this medical condition or “disability” does not have to be total disability as it is the case of Social Security Disability Retirement cases. The medical condition must be expected to last a minimum of a year.

The rise has come even as medical advances have allowed many more people to … indiana comprehensive health insurance planWebMar 14, 2024 · The cost can vary based on your age and the level of benefits, but some estimates state that you should expect to pay between one and three percent of your annual gross income. So, if you’re earning a $50,000 salary, purchasing your own short-term disability policy could cost between $500 and $1,500 each year. indiana compulsory gymnastics state meetWebSep 26, 2024 · How Much You Can Receive In Disability Benefits?
